Who might be able to join this trial:
- People who are 18 years of age or older
- People who are able to read, understand, and sign a consent form agreeing to take part
- People who are scheduled to have surgery to remove a tumor inside the spinal canal, where nerve monitoring is used during the operation
Who may not be able to join:
- People who have a pacemaker or any other implanted electrical medical device
- People who are pregnant or currently breastfeeding
- People who have a serious medical, neurological, or psychiatric condition that may make it difficult to fully follow the study requirements
- People who have a history of skull fractures or have previously had brain surgery
- People whose overall health before surgery is rated as higher risk (above grade 2 on a standard anaesthesia health scale — confirm with trial site)
- People who are currently taking blood-thinning medications
- People who have a tear in the protective covering of the spinal cord that is causing spinal fluid to leak
- People who have a history of seizures or epilepsy

Primary endpoints
Elevation in blood concentration of CNS biomarkers following BDF compared to biomarkers detected in CSF of the same subject. The overall incidence of BDF procedure-related AEs and SAEs, with severity graded according to CTCAE v5.0 criteria.
